Subject: Re: [PATCH v3 2/4] i2c: piix4: Move SB800_PIIX4_FCH_PM_ADDR definition to amd_node.h
Date: Sun, 13 Apr 2025 10:44:16 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<Z_t5YADNi0vpPqGO@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<Z_ttp0ZNHEpNhh_9@gmail.com>


* Ingo Molnar <mingo@kernel.org> wrote:

> 
> * Borislav Petkov <bp@alien8.de> wrote:
> 
> > I was aiming more for a header which contains non-CPU defines - 
> > i.e., platform. But the FCH is only one part of that platform. But 
> > let's start with amd/fch.h - "amd/" subpath element would allow us 
> > to trivially put other headers there too - and see where it gets 
> > us. We can (and will) always refactor later if needed...
> 
> Yeah, agreed on opening the <asm/amd/> namespace for this.

Here's a tree that establishes <asm/amd/> and moves existing headers 
there:

  git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mingo/tip.git WIP.x86/platform

Mario, could you base your series on top of this tree?

Thanks,

	Ingo

===============>
Ingo Molnar (6):
  x86/platform/amd: Move the <asm/amd-ibs.h> header to <asm/amd/ibs.h>
  x86/platform/amd: Add standard header guards to <asm/amd/ibs.h>
  x86/platform/amd: Move the <asm/amd_nb.h> header to <asm/amd/nb.h>
  x86/platform/amd: Move the <asm/amd_hsmp.h> header to <asm/amd/hsmp.h>
  x86/platform/amd: Clean up the <asm/amd/hsmp.h> header guards a bit
  x86/platform/amd: Move the <asm/amd_node.h> header to <asm/amd/node.h>
